The Lawful Devices of Prenups in Shielding Possessions
Notably, prenuptial agreements serve as a powerful legal device for guarding assets among cohabiting couples. As a legitimately binding agreement, a prenup specifies the division of assets and economic commitments in instance of a partnership discontinuation. By defining the home legal rights of each event, it eliminates prospective conflicts over asset ownership. In the occasion of fatality, a prenup can additionally supply quality on inheritance issues, superseding conflicting instructions in a will or trust fund. Prenups can protect individual businesses, future revenues, and retired life benefits as well. While they do not identify child wardship or youngster assistance problems, prenups efficiently manage the financial aspects of a connection, ensuring reasonable distribution and shielding individual properties. They comprise a sensible action in securing one's monetary future.

Managing Prenup Misconceptions and Controversies
Are prenuptial contracts shrouded in false impressions click for more info and conflicts? Some might state so. These lawful files are typically wrongly deemed preparing for divorce or suggesting an absence of trust, which can hinder couples from signing them. Prenups are just a sensible way to safeguard one's possessions in the unexpected future. One more typical false impression is the idea that they are just for the well-off. In reality, prenuptial agreements can profit any type of couple by developing clear monetary borders and assumptions. Disputes commonly occur when a prenup is considered "unreasonable" or "forceful". To stay clear of such problems, each party must have independent lawful suggestions throughout the composing process and guarantee all disclosures are made honestly and completely.
